WebbRomberg test - the patient stands with his / her feet together and arms crossed. The patient is asked to maintain this position with eyes open and then eyes closed. It is usually stopped at around 30 seconds. Sharpened Romberg - this test is similar to the Romberg, but this version is performed in tandem standing with eyes open and closed. WebbThe maximum bal ance time for the sharpened Romberg test was 60 seconds. For the one-legged stance test, a maximum balance time was 30 seconds. WebbAbstract The Sharpened Romberg Test (SRT) is a test of balance commonly used in Diving Medicine. Interpretation of an abnormal test can be confounded by several factors. This study was conducted to further evaluate the usefulness of the SRT. In the first part of the study, naval and civilian volunteers in a Naval Base were recruited as subjects.
